- The distance between Melville Hall, Dominica and Nebitdag, Turkmenistan is approximately 10,975 km or 6,820 mi.
- To reach Melville Hall in this distance one would set out from Nebitdag bearing 298.5° or WNW and follow the great circles arc to approach Melville Hall bearing 224.7° or SW .
- Melville Hall has a tropical rainforest climate (Af) whereas Nebitdag has a mid-latitude cool desert climate (BWk).
- The average annual temperature is 8.7 °C (15.6°F) warmer.
- Average monthly temperatures vary by 25.7 °C (46.3°F) less in Melville Hall. The continentality subtype is extremely hyperoceanic as opposed to truly continental.
- Total annual precipitation averages 2432 mm (95.7 in) more which is equivalent to 2432 l/m² (59.69 US gal/ft²) or 24,320,000 l/ha (2,599,969 US gal/ac) more. About 18 as much.
- The altitude of the sun at midday is overall 21° higher in Melville Hall than in Nebitdag.
